Product Description

The TTM 57SL combines the best Rane and Serato have to offer in a single, high performance mixer. Finally a mixer that fully integrates mixer hardware, software and software controls in one powerful package. The TTM 57SL combines all the performance and features of the Rane TTM 56 with Serato Scratch LIVE software.Rane didn't stop there --they also included internal effects with six stereo insert points. The TTM 57SL allows the user to simultaneously:Play a combination of digital and analog sources. Play up to two digital files controlled by vinyl or CD while recording your mix. Or, record two stereo sources when not using vinyl or CD control. Cue analog and digital sources. Operate standalone as a no-compromise performance mixer. I've had this mixer for one year now and it's served me well. I did have to send the unit in for servicing twice already.. once to repair a faulty B1 button and twice when the first servicing bent an LED during repairs.

An inconvenience, but RANE's customer service is superb. When the warranty goes out, I'll be singin' a different tune, but for now, it's perfect.

Looking forward to picking up a newly released 'Video-SL' plug-in very soon, where you can use this mixer for mixing video. You can do so in demo on the SSL version 1.8 software currently, but to export the video full screen for any sort of performance, you need to purchase a license.

I bought this mixer because I heard good things about Rane. I can't say I'm very impressed. The LED card that illuminates the lights in between the two channel faders fell off down into the unit within the first month. I had to open up the box and glue it back on myself. The faders are AWESOME - they are like butter, and SO precise. However, the rest of the mixer does NOT reflect the quality of the faders...

First, the headphone volume knob; it goes from silent to painful ear-splitting volume with barely a touch. This thing is the OPPOSITE of precise. It comes in only in one channel or the other up from silence, and then practically deafens you if you don't exercise extreme caution when turning it up. I have NEVER turned this particular volume knob up past about 25%. If I did, I would surely destroy my headphones and ears alike. The knobs on this thing feel flimsy and cheap.

Next, the buttons; oh, where to begin. They are GARBAGE. UTTER TRASH. I hate - ABSOLUTELY HATE - the buttons on this thing. They are short-travel buttons, which are great when the hardware is quality and they actually work. On this thing, that is not the case. Most often, they don't register the key-stroke, even though you can feel the "click" of the button. Then, you have to mash them in and hope they respond. Once you have clicked it a couple times, then you mash on it, and then it double-registers. So, you'll hit the button a couple times with no response, then you FORCE it down and it will toggle on/off in the same key-stroke. FORGET about queuing with these things. 100% unreliable. I only ever use them to get back near the beginning of a track, which is always immediately followed by some manual correction. All the buttons suffer the same poor performance and quality. These are the types of problems I would expect from far cheaper brands/mixers.

Pros: faders

Cons: buttons, knobs, price, overall quality of hardware, build-quality, pretty much everything but the faders, NOT professional quality hardware

THE PRICE OF THIS MIXER IS NOT REFLECTED IN THE PRODUCT. Very expensive mixer with some really crummy features. I would NOT buy this mixer again, nor would I recommend it to others.

I have owned the ttm57 Rane Mixer for three years and I have fun every time I use it.

Pros: The Mixer works great with Serato and SL Video. I like the loop adjustment ease, and effects. Once I got used to how it worked it was easier to map in the dark. I used all of the connections on the back and I think they work great. The Mic input works better than my mic mixer. I have two Technics mk1200s connected to it for vinyl control with Serato. I like the feel of the vinyl, and the easy integration with analog. I often play sets with both, and I like to have digital on one side and analog on the other, and it sounds great. The Headphone fader is also an excellent feature, and must have.

Cons: The buttons are small, I would rather have lighted buttons, especially for the dark DJ sets. I also wish the Headphone jack was higher on the front of the case due to it hitting my flight case.
